Working Principles

The VS-VSKN71/04 operates based on the principle of feedback control, where it continuously monitors the output voltage and adjusts the internal circuitry to maintain the desired voltage level. By comparing the actual output voltage with a reference voltage, the regulator makes real-time adjustments to ensure stability.
